1048 NE 208th St #0, Miami, FL 33179$3,090/moFees may apply3 bds2.5 ba1,812 sqft - Townhouse for rentShow more 3D TourSave this home
947 NE 211th St #947, Miami, FL 33179$2,825/moFees may apply3 bds2.5 ba1,403 sqft - Townhouse for rentShow more 3D TourSave this home
267 NE 201st Ter #267, North Miami Beach, FL 33179$3,000/moFees may apply3 bds2 ba1,404 sqft - Townhouse for rentShow more 3D TourSave this home
21255 NE 8th Pl APT 8, Miami, FL 33179$2,499/moFees may apply3 bds2 ba1,230 sqft - Townhouse for rentShow more 3D TourSave this home